Our child care and early education centre is located in Waterloo on the ground floor of the Vista Grande by Meriton building, ideally located for families in Zetland too. We’re just opposite Wulaba Park and close to Moore Park Supa Centre and East Village Shopping Centre.

Children engage in cooking experiences with our centre cook, participate in engaging programs and practice sustainability throughout the centre and with our vegetable garden. 

We value children’s interest and individual development, so our program design is focused on children’s cultural identity, emotional well-being, social communication, and international mindedness. The daily experiences embed a variety of learning elements, such as literacy and numeracy, STEM program, arts, physical, music and more.

As soon as you step foot in our centre, you will be immersed in a world where children are encouraged to explore and learn. Our all-weather play areas which feature two age-appropriate playgrounds, rainbow bike tracks, bridges, two large sandpits, veggie gardens, a cubby house, a slide, a water play area and a stage for outdoor performance.

Children are provided time and space for uninterrupted play as they explore the outdoors to test their limits and develop strength, balance, and self-confidence. Being outside supports children’s overall health and wellbeing.

The centre kitchen is at the heart of everything we do. We provide nutritious meals created daily by our in-house cook, catering for all dietary requirements. Shared mealtimes between children and educators strengthen relationships, with opportunities to share stories and experiences, and model healthy eating practices. Your child will have access to a rotating schedule of engaging specialised programs, including sports program, Yoga classes, music lessons and French classes. These fun and engaging programs enhance the daily program.

Throughout the year we welcome special guests and community members to the centre based on the children's interests, such as pet ownership, emergency services, local dentist, Australian Wildlife Display, science and more. We also venture out on regular excursions exploring our local community, parks, East Village Shopping Centre and Wulaba Park to promote connection with nature and active participation in the broader community.

Neighbourhood connections support a sense of community and belonging for children and provide opportunities to develop social and observational skills with different people, places, and environments.

We embrace regular cultural events reflecting the diversity in our local community. We welcome all our families to join us to celebrate Harmony Day, Chinese New Year, Diwali Day, Easter, Christmas and other special events throughout the year.

Fees
Age Group Daily Fee
Nursery $164.00
Toddler $161.00
Kindergarten $157.00

Note: Fees effective from 10 July 2023.

Your family’s daily out of pocket cost will depend on your Childcare Subsidy (CCS) entitlements. 

The above fees are before the Child Care Subsidy has been applied. To calculate your estimated subsidy, view our subsidy calculator. We also offer 9-hour, 10-hour and full-day options at our centre which could help optimise your child care subsidy.
